What Happened at the Sangeet?
According to Amita Muchhal, Smriti’s father Srinivas Mandhana was in high spirits during pre-wedding celebrations. He danced enthusiastically throughout the sangeet night and was actively sharing joyful moments on Instagram stories. However, the very next day while planning the baraat procession, he began experiencing discomfort.

Initially, Srinivas didn’t mention his symptoms, but as they worsened, the family called an ambulance. The sudden medical emergency brought all wedding festivities to an immediate halt.
Palash’s Emotional Breakdown
What makes this situation particularly poignant is Palash’s deep bond with his future father-in-law. Amita revealed that Palash shares an exceptionally close relationship with Srinivas—even closer than Smriti’s bond with her father.
When the health crisis occurred, it was Palash who first decided to postpone the wedding, refusing to proceed with the pheras until Srinivas fully recovered. The emotional stress took such a severe toll that Palash was hospitalized for four hours, requiring IV drips and medical tests including an ECG.
Amita shared that after the haldi ceremony, they kept Palash indoors, but he broke down crying continuously. While all medical tests came back normal, doctors confirmed he was under tremendous stress. His sister, renowned singer Palak Muchhal, was spotted visiting him at a Mumbai hospital.
Smriti Mandhana’s Response
Following the postponement, Smriti and her friends deleted all wedding-related photos from their social media accounts, signaling the couple’s decision to pause celebrations until Srinivas recovers. The gesture reflects the family’s priority: health and well-being over ceremony.
